PowerDesigner中创建Oracle表全过程记录

时间:2023-03-10 00:10:08
PowerDesigner中创建Oracle表全过程记录

本文记录如何在PowerDesigner中创建一个Oracle结构的表。

在进行本文阅读之前,需要在PowerDesigner进行 DBMS修改,DataBase创建,用户创建,表空间创建。

 

1.创建表,填写name,code,comment,owner(需要提前创建)

PowerDesigner中创建Oracle表全过程记录

2.创建表中的对应的列

PowerDesigner中创建Oracle表全过程记录

2.1对主键进行编辑,选择主键后,点击属性按钮(第一个按钮)

PowerDesigner中创建Oracle表全过程记录

2.2确认name,code,table,PrimaryKey之后,添加Sequence,修改name,code,owner

PowerDesigner中创建Oracle表全过程记录

2.3修改sequence的相关选项

PowerDesigner中创建Oracle表全过程记录

2.4确保sequence的定义正确

PowerDesigner中创建Oracle表全过程记录

3.创建索引,创建name,code,是否是唯一索引

PowerDesigner中创建Oracle表全过程记录

选中某一条索引之后,进行属性编辑,确认name,code,owner。

PowerDesigner中创建Oracle表全过程记录

选择索引对应的列信息

PowerDesigner中创建Oracle表全过程记录

进行索引的参数定义。

PowerDesigner中创建Oracle表全过程记录

确保索引的定义时正确的。

PowerDesigner中创建Oracle表全过程记录

4进行主键编辑

PowerDesigner中创建Oracle表全过程记录

修改name,code,确认其他内容

PowerDesigner中创建Oracle表全过程记录

选择主键对应的列

PowerDesigner中创建Oracle表全过程记录

去掉使用Index选项(根据情况选择)

PowerDesigner中创建Oracle表全过程记录

确保定义正确

PowerDesigner中创建Oracle表全过程记录

5.删除自动添加的trigger

PowerDesigner中创建Oracle表全过程记录

确认是否正常

PowerDesigner中创建Oracle表全过程记录

6.修改表的参数信息

PowerDesigner中创建Oracle表全过程记录

可以通过点击放大镜来进行修改。

PowerDesigner中创建Oracle表全过程记录

PowerDesigner中创建Oracle表全过程记录

确定结果是否正常

PowerDesigner中创建Oracle表全过程记录

7.确认最终结果是否正常

PowerDesigner中创建Oracle表全过程记录